Good kick pad but I had to adjust a few things.
Gerardo5491 15.07.2020
I hope Thomann will take note of my review, it can be extremely helpful for quality control.
So,
Playability - Great, I'm using this with my Roland Octapad and my Gibraltar double pedal, so now you can take note that it works perfect for double pedal.
Construction is very strong, nothing to complain.
Noise emission, yes you will have some knock knock noise but nothing extreme, definitely the fact that this is a mesh head helps a lot reducing noise. If you place it over a carpet even less noise.

Cons - Why I'm giving two stars in Quality?
Ok, quality is not bad at all, it is great but the reason why I'm giving two stars is because I had to open it and make some modifications to fix a problem, which not every person would know how to fix.
I started playing and there was almost no response, almost no volume, but Im experienced in this ( I had the same problem with the Millenium mesh head Snare drum ) and so what happens here is that inside the pad, there is a sensor, this sensor has some centimetres of soft padding (sponge like) which are supposed to touch the mesh head, so it would sense every beat from the kick pedal, but the problem is that such padding (sponge) is not long enough to touch the mesh head, well it touches it but not firm enough, so you play and it is like you are not hitting hard enough, so what I had to do is that I opened the pad, I added a few extra centimetres of sponge, I cut it the same size and shape and pasted it with super glue, put back the mesh head and now it sounds amazing, now it has the right amount of sensitiveness. This is all the same what I did with the snare drum, some models have a velocimeter that you can adjust with a screw, to lower or to higher the sensitiveness or let's say, volume, but that didn't help, I needed to add extra sponge.

Well I hope Thomann team will take care of this detail because not everybody would figure out how to fix this, many people could end up thinking that it has a poor performance or could end up sending it back, but any other than this, the kick pad is amazing, responsive for double kick pedal, strong and so on.

For the price, you can't do better.
WelshPhil 16.09.2020
I used this pedal to upgrade my Roland TD-1KV kit.

I didn't want to spend so much money on the Roland kick drum (half the price of the original kit itself), but wanted to have a proper bass pedal feel to my kit and so gave this a try.

For the price, you really can't do better.

The bounce back off the skin is so much more like a real drum skin and so I can now play much faster and am able to add both a funk/ swing feel to my playing as well as a heavier feel to metal etc.

I didn't want to review it until I had worn it in, so waited, and having beaten it to death for the last few weeks, it really does have good build quality for the price.

The acoustic sound is quiet, (not that I care at all about that, but some might), but the thing that I was most shocked by was how sturdy it is. It does not rock at all, or move across the floor.

It has adjustable spikes to keep it in place, but also has velcro that sticks it to the carpet. Be careful if you have expensive carpet, because this sticks like glue to carpets. You really have to pull to pick it up again. It will NOT move if you don't want it to, which has always been a problem for me while playing hard and the drums moving across the floor, so this is very good for me.

Response is also very good. It picks up very fast playing and is able to distinguish between hard and soft beats.

I would recommend this to anyone.

Good, silent, not compatible with Alesis Turbo mesh at all
DottMasterPorro 10.04.2021
I thought it was compatible with my Alesis Turbo Mesh, but the trigger control unit does not recognize the pad. By replacing the entrance with the floor tom it works. Using with the Mac and ESX24 sampler and assign a kick wave to the floor tom midi signal is perfect.
I confirm the problem of the sensor too low in relation to the skin. Instead of putting extra foam rubber I preferred to raise the sensor by replacing the 4 mounting screws of 16mm with others of 30mm. To raise it I used rubber blocks, and by lifting it 8mm it adheres perfectly to the skin.
Now there is only the problem that the floor tom with the cable dedicated to the previous kick has a low sensitivity, and it would be necessary to change the control unit. The pad with the pedal is real, quite unlike the original Alesis pad. The hi-hat pedal should also be changed...

Value for the price
cr_az 03.08.2022
I've bought it as an upgrade for Alesis Nitro Mesh, so I could use it with a double-pedal setup.
In general, it works great and as long as you use plastic/rubber beater - it looks and works better than the one from Alesis. A year later - only minor evidence of wear and tear.
